WebJan 22, 2024 · Darkvision is a special sense that allows a creature in 5e to see dim light as if it were bright light and to see in darkness as if it were dim light, up to a certain listed radius. It does not allow you to see in magical darkness. Below is the official text for darkvision as it appears in the stat block for the Owlin playable race. WebJan 18, 2024 · Technically, yes. WebRules as written, Darkvision only allows you to see in darkness: Within a specified range, a creature with darkvision can see in darkness as if the darkness were dim light, so areas of darkness are only lightly obscured as far as that creature is concerned. WebJan 22, 2024 · There are three types of cover: half cover, three-quarters cover, and full cover. A target has half cover if they’re behind cover which obscures over half of their body from an attacker. This gives a +2 bonus to the target’s AC and a +2 bonus to dexterity saves when resolving attacks from that attacker. If three-quarters of a target’s ... WebLight You touch one object that is no larger than 10 feet in any dimension. Until the spell ends, the object sheds bright light in a 20-foot radius and dim light for an additional 20 feet. The light can be colored as you like. Completely covering the object with something opaque blocks the light. WebDec 22, 2024 · The rules for Light in DnD 5e are as follows: Light remains visible on an invisble target. This was confirmed by the game’s developers — “The invisibility spell doesn’t prevent you or your gear from emitting light, yet that light makes you no less invisible.”
